Transaction 078315955998cb3520f40f72602e74858b7ef630e6c4e22bc2206bb9e54902a0
1 Input
1 Output
-
078315955998cb3520f40f72602e74858b7ef630e6c4e22bc2206bb9e54902a0:0
- value
- 84864669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 459eff027352785e534b6a1fd067ca622a8ab14b OP_EQUAL
- address
- MEFHKup2xM46MNDbmThP7C1wj1qiTdM9TC